How To Become a Middle School Teacher in Maryland 2025

Discover the steps to becoming a certified middle school teacher in Maryland, from meeting education and testing requirements to exploring subject-area options, teacher salaries, and available financial aid.

Middle school teachers guide students through an important stage of academic and personal development, helping them gain subject knowledge and build critical thinking skills. To get started, you can review the general steps for how to become a middle school teacher before exploring Maryland's specific certification process.

This article outlines each step to becoming a certified teacher, from completing your degree to passing exams and choosing a subject area. You'll also learn about job prospects, average salaries, and financial aid options.

What Does a Middle School Teacher Do?

Middle school teachers help students in grades six through eight develop subject knowledge while supporting their growth as independent learners. These educators create lesson plans, deliver instruction, and assess student progress across core academic areas. They also play a key role in supporting students' emotional and social development as they transition from childhood to adolescence.

To qualify for the role, you must meet specific middle school teacher educational requirements, including completing a bachelor's degree and an approved educator preparation program. Certification also requires passing relevant exams and a background check.

Middle school teachers in Maryland are expected to manage a wide range of classroom and instructional responsibilities, including the following:

  • developing lesson plans aligned with Maryland College and Career Ready Standards
  • teaching content in subjects like math, science, English, or social studies
  • creating a supportive, inclusive classroom environment
  • assessing student learning and adjusting instruction based on performance
  • collaborating with other educators and support staff
  • communicating regularly with parents or guardians
  • attending professional development and school events

How To Become a Middle School Teacher in Maryland

Maryland requires middle school teachers to meet specific academic and certification criteria to teach in public schools. Most candidates follow a traditional preparation pathway that includes a bachelor's degree, an educator preparation program, and state certification exams. Other approved routes include alternative certification and resident teacher programs. To understand how this process compares nationally, see the requirements to become a middle school teacher.

Step 1: Complete a Bachelor's Degree and Educator Preparation Program

You must first earn a bachelor's degree from a regionally accredited institution. Your degree should include a concentration in a content area commonly taught in middle school, such as English, mathematics, or science. Maryland does not offer a standalone middle school certification, so students generally pursue dual certification in elementary and secondary or in a single secondary subject for grades seven to 12.

Your degree must also include completion of an approved educator preparation program. This program includes coursework in instructional methods, learning theory, and classroom management, along with field experiences and student teaching. These components are required for certification eligibility.

Step 2: Pass Required Praxis Exams

After completing your academic program, you must pass the required Praxis exams. These typically include the Praxis Core Academic Skills for Educators (if not waived by SAT/ACT scores) and the Praxis II subject assessment specific to your content area.

The subject exam ensures you have the depth of knowledge necessary to teach your chosen discipline. You may also need to take the Principles of Learning and Teaching (PLT) exam for grades five to nine or seven to 12, depending on your certification area. All test scores must be submitted with your certification application.

Step 3: Apply for Certification Through MSDE

Once all academic and testing requirements are met, you can apply for certification through the Maryland State Department of Education (MSDE). You'll need to submit official transcripts, Praxis scores, and verification of program completion.

Applications are submitted online or by mail, and you must also complete a background check and fingerprinting. Once approved, you'll receive a Standard Professional Certificate (SPC I), which allows you to begin teaching in Maryland public schools.

Step 4: Consider Alternative Certification Options (If Applicable)

If you already hold a bachelor's degree but did not complete a teacher preparation program, Maryland offers alternative certification routes. These include the Resident Teacher Certificate (RTC), which allows you to teach while completing preparation coursework, often through partnerships with school districts.

These programs are designed for career changers and include intensive mentoring, pedagogy training, and job-embedded learning. Candidates must still meet testing requirements and complete their certification pathway within a specified timeframe.

Step 5: Maintain and Upgrade Your Certification

After receiving your initial certification, you'll need to meet continuing education requirements to renew or upgrade your license. Maryland requires six semester hours of professional development or coursework every five years to maintain certification.

With continued teaching experience and additional requirements met, you can advance to the Standard Professional Certificate II (SPC II) and later to the Advanced Professional Certificate (APC), which allows for longer renewal periods and additional teaching flexibility.

Middle School Requirements By Subject

In Maryland, certification for middle school teaching is typically earned through secondary content-area licensure, which covers grades seven to 12. While there is no stand-alone middle school certification, teachers can still work in middle grades by earning certification in a specific subject area and completing the appropriate coursework. Below are the general steps required to become certified in core teaching subjects.

How To Become a Middle School Math Teacher

To teach math in Maryland middle schools, you'll need a bachelor's degree with a strong emphasis in mathematics. Your coursework should include algebra, geometry, calculus, statistics, and other advanced math topics, along with a teacher preparation program that includes field experiences and instructional strategies for adolescent learners.

You must also pass the Praxis II Mathematics: Content Knowledge exam, as required by the Maryland State Department of Education. With all requirements met, you'll be eligible for certification to teach math in grades seven to 12, which qualifies you for middle school teaching positions.

How To Become a Middle School Science Teacher

If you plan to teach science at the middle level, you'll need a bachelor's degree that includes coursework in biology, chemistry, earth science, and physics, as well as classes on lab instruction and science teaching methods. Your educator preparation program should also focus on instructional practices appropriate for grades six to eight.

To become certified, you must pass the Praxis II science exam relevant to your subject area, such as biology or general science. This certification allows you to teach science in grades seven to 12, including middle school classrooms across Maryland.

How To Become a Middle School History Teacher

To teach history in Maryland middle schools, you'll need a bachelor's degree with substantial coursework in U.S. history, world history, government, geography, and economics. Your teacher preparation program should include both content pedagogy and adolescent learning strategies.

You'll also be required to pass the Praxis II Social Studies: Content Knowledge exam. Once certified, you can teach social studies or history in grades seven to 12, making you eligible for middle school teaching roles.

How To Become a Middle School English Language Arts Teacher

Aspiring English teachers must earn a bachelor's degree with coursework in grammar, composition, literature, reading analysis, and language development. In addition to these content areas, you'll complete a teacher preparation program that includes adolescent literacy instruction and classroom-based experiences.

To meet Maryland's certification requirements, you must pass the Praxis II English Language Arts: Content Knowledge exam. This license allows you to teach English in seventh to twelfth grade, including middle school grades.

Education Degree Programs in Maryland

Several Maryland universities offer state-approved programs that prepare students for middle school teaching certification. These programs combine subject-area coursework with classroom experiences and licensure support.

1. Towson University

Towson University offers a Bachelor of Science in education in middle school education designed for students seeking certification in grades four through nine. The program allows candidates to specialize in two subject areas from English, mathematics, science, or social studies, preparing them to teach in interdisciplinary settings.

Students complete a structured sequence of education courses, field experiences, and a full semester of student teaching. Coursework includes adolescent development, instructional methods, and content-specific pedagogy aligned with Maryland certification requirements. Graduates are eligible for licensure upon successful program completion and required exam passage.

  • Estimated tuition cost: $12,186 (in-state); $31,332 (out-of-state)
  • Accreditation: Middle States Commission on Higher Education (MSCHE)

2. Frostburg State University

At Frostburg State University, students can pursue a Bachelor of Science in education through the elementary/middle school dual certification program, which prepares candidates to teach in grades one through nine. The program includes a strong foundation in education theory, instructional strategies, and field experiences, along with the choice of a content-area focus such as language arts, math, science, or social studies.

Frostburg also offers a Master of Arts in Teaching (MAT) for individuals who already hold a non-teaching bachelor's degree. The MAT program provides an accelerated path to certification with coursework and clinical practice designed to meet Maryland's licensure requirements.

  • Estimated tuition cost: $7,414 (in-state); $23,306 (out-of-state)
  • Accreditation: MSCHE

3. Salisbury University

Salisbury University provides multiple pathways for students interested in teaching middle school, including options for undergraduate majors and minors that align with certification in grades four through nine. Students pursuing a degree in education can enhance their qualifications by adding a middle school science education minor, which focuses on instructional methods, curriculum development, and classroom practices tailored to adolescent learners.

The Samuel W. and Marilyn C. Seidel School of Education offers field-based experiences, faculty mentorship, and access to state-approved certification programs. Through a combination of content-area coursework and practical training, graduates are prepared for licensure and careers in Maryland middle schools.

  • Estimated tuition cost: $11,306 (in-state); $22,810 (out-of-state)
  • Accreditation: MSCHE

4. University of Maryland, Baltimore County

The University of Maryland, Baltimore County (UMBC) offers a Bachelor of Arts in education through its middle grades STEM (MG-STEM) program, designed for students planning to teach math or science in grades four through nine. This interdisciplinary program includes coursework in STEM content areas, teaching methods, and adolescent development, along with clinical experiences in local schools.

UMBC also offers secondary education certification programs that qualify graduates to teach in grades seven to 12, which may include opportunities in middle school classrooms. All education programs combine subject-area preparation with field-based learning aligned with Maryland's teacher certification requirements.

  • Estimated tuition cost: $13,257 (in-state); $31,225 (out-of-state)
  • Accreditation: MSCHE

5. Bowie State University

Bowie State University offers degree pathways for students interested in teaching middle or secondary school, including a Bachelor of Science in science education and a Bachelor of Science in secondary education. These programs prepare students for certification in grades seven to 12, which includes eligibility to teach in middle school classrooms across Maryland.

The programs combine core education coursework with subject-specific classes in areas like biology, chemistry, or general science. Students participate in early field experiences and complete a full semester of student teaching. Both degrees meet Maryland State Department of Education certification requirements and are designed to support careers in public school teaching.

  • Estimated tuition cost: $6,325 (in-state); $17,170 (out-of-state)
  • Accreditation: MSCHE

Middle School Teacher Salary in Maryland

The average middle school teacher salary in Maryland is $79,000 per year, according to the U.S. Bureau of Labor Statistics. This figure reflects the mean wage for teachers in grades six through eight across public and private schools. Salaries may vary based on district funding, years of experience, and additional certifications.

Compared to the national average of $62,970, Maryland's compensation for middle school teachers is notably higher. Teachers in metropolitan areas like Baltimore and the D.C. suburbs may earn above-average salaries due to higher living costs and regional demand for qualified educators.

Job Outlook for Middle School Teachers in Maryland

While employment for middle school teachers nationwide is projected to decline by 1% from 2023 to 2033, opportunities will still exist. The U.S. Bureau of Labor Statistics estimates that about 41,400 positions will open each year due to retirements, career changes, and workforce exits.

In Maryland, school systems continue to face teacher shortages in critical subject areas, which may lead to ongoing demand despite the national trend. New teachers entering the profession are likely to find job opportunities in rural areas or in high-need schools and subject fields.

Financial Aid for Middle School Teacher Programs

Students preparing to become middle school teachers in Maryland have several financial aid options. You can begin by completing the Free Application for Federal Student Aid (FAFSA) to access federal grants, subsidized loans, and work-study opportunities. Many cheap online colleges that accept FAFSA offer teaching programs that qualify for these benefits.

Maryland also provides state-specific financial support. The Teaching Fellows for Maryland Scholarship helps cover tuition for students who commit to teaching in public schools after graduation. Additional aid may be available through the Maryland Higher Education Commission (MHEC), which oversees grant and scholarship programs for in-state residents pursuing education degrees.

FAQs About Becoming a Middle School Teacher in Maryland

If you're considering a teaching career in Maryland, it's helpful to understand the timelines, degree options, and financial pathways available. These common questions cover what to expect as you work toward becoming a certified middle school teacher.

How Long Does It Take To Become a Middle School Teacher in Maryland?

It typically takes about four years to become a middle school teacher in Maryland if you follow a traditional undergraduate program that includes teacher certification. Additional time may be needed if you pursue alternative certification after earning a non-teaching degree.

Can You Become a Teacher in Maryland Without a Teaching Degree?

Yes, Maryland offers alternative certification routes for individuals with a bachelor's degree in a non-education field. These programs allow candidates to begin teaching while completing the required coursework and exams for full certification.

What Is the Fastest Way To Become a Teacher?

The fastest way to start teaching is through a resident teacher or alternative certification program, which allows you to teach while completing your education requirements. These pathways are ideal for career changers who already hold a degree.

How Can I Become a Teacher in Maryland for Free?

You may be able to reduce or eliminate your costs through financial aid, state scholarships, or service-based programs that offer tuition assistance in exchange for teaching commitments. Maryland also offers teaching fellowships that cover tuition for students who agree to teach in high-need areas.

Can You Start Teaching With an Associate Degree?

An associate degree alone does not meet the certification requirements to teach in Maryland public schools. However, it can be used as a starting point toward a bachelor's degree and eventual licensure through a four-year transfer program.

Explore Teaching Degrees in Maryland

Browse accredited teaching degree programs in Maryland to find the right fit for your goals. Learn.org features colleges that offer licensure pathways and subject-area preparation for future middle school teachers.